Why Does Water Keep Appearing in the Same Part of Your Basement?

You clean up a small puddle in the corner of the basement, dry everything out, and move on. Then another storm rolls through and the water appears in exactly the same place.

Recurring water in one section of a basement is rarely random. Water tends to follow the easiest available path. The place where it collects may not be the exact point where it entered, but its location can still provide an important clue.

By paying attention to where the water appears, when it happens, and what is located outside that section of the foundation, homeowners can often narrow down the possible cause.

Start With the Area Directly Outside

When one basement wall or corner repeatedly gets wet, begin by walking around the outside of the house.

Find the area directly opposite the wet spot. Look for anything that could be concentrating water near the foundation, such as a downspout, window well, outdoor faucet, garden bed, patio, walkway, or low area in the yard.

Soil can gradually settle beside a house and create a shallow depression. During a long or heavy storm, that low area may collect water instead of allowing it to drain away.

Landscaping can unintentionally create the same problem. Adding mulch, soil, edging, or a raised garden bed may change how water moves around the house. Even when the yard looks relatively level, a slight slope toward the foundation can direct runoff into the same area whenever it rains.

Check the Gutters and Downspouts

A gutter problem does not always cause moisture along the entire basement. One clogged section or poorly placed downspout may repeatedly soak a specific part of the foundation.

During the next rainfall, watch how water moves from the roof. It should enter the gutters, travel through the downspouts, and be released far enough from the house that it continues flowing away from the foundation.

If water spills over the edge of a clogged gutter, it may fall directly beside the house. A disconnected downspout or short extension can also release a large amount of roof runoff into a relatively small area.

Do not assume an underground downspout line is working simply because the pipe disappears beneath the soil. Underground drainage lines can become blocked, crushed, or disconnected. When that happens, water may back up or collect beside the foundation.

Look Closely at Basement Windows

Basement windows are another common source of recurring water, particularly when they sit below ground level.

Leaves, dirt, mulch, and other debris can collect inside a window well and interfere with drainage. During heavy rain, the well may begin to fill. Water can then leak around the window frame, enter through small gaps, or rise above the sill.

Inspect the inside of the window for water stains, peeling paint, damaged trim, rust, or dampness around the frame. The wall directly below the window may also show a narrow trail where water has been running.

A window well cover can help keep out direct rainfall and debris, but it will not solve every drainage problem. If the surrounding soil slopes toward the well or the drain beneath it is clogged, water may continue collecting there.

Inspect Visible Foundation Cracks

A foundation crack can explain why moisture keeps returning to one narrow, predictable section of the basement.

Water may pass through a crack in poured concrete or deteriorated mortar joints in a block foundation. Sometimes the opening is easy to see. In other cases, it may be hidden behind shelves, insulation, paneling, drywall, or a coat of paint.

Look for more than an obvious stream of water. White mineral deposits, bubbling paint, dark staining, rust, or a damp line can all help reveal where moisture has been traveling.

Keep in mind that the puddle may form below or several feet away from the actual entry point. Water can run down a wall, follow a pipe, or move behind finished materials before reaching the floor.

Not every crack has the same cause or requires the same repair. The width, direction, location, and amount of movement all matter. A crack that is widening, leaking heavily, or accompanied by a bowing wall should be professionally evaluated.

Pay Attention to the Wall and Floor Joint

Some basement leaks appear where the foundation wall meets the floor. This area is commonly called the cove joint.

When the soil surrounding and beneath a home becomes saturated, water pressure can build against the foundation. Moisture may then find its way through the joint between the wall and floor or through small openings in the concrete.

This can create a damp line along one wall or a puddle that begins in the same corner after periods of heavy or repeated rainfall.

The timing can be confusing. Water may not appear when the rain first starts. It can take time for the ground to become saturated, so seepage may begin several hours into a storm or even after the rain has stopped.

Painting or sealing the visible area may temporarily cover the symptoms, but a surface coating does not address the water collecting outside or beneath the foundation. If the underlying pressure remains, moisture may eventually return.

Finished Walls Can Hide the Water’s Path

Finding the source becomes more difficult when the basement is finished.

Water may enter through the foundation, travel behind drywall, and finally appear where the wall meets the flooring. By that point, the visible puddle may be several feet from the original opening.

Watch for swollen baseboards, peeling paint, soft drywall, loose flooring, discolored carpet, or a musty odor that becomes stronger after rain. These signs may appear before an obvious puddle develops.

Avoid repeatedly replacing damaged trim or repainting the wall without investigating why the area became wet. Cosmetic repairs can hide the evidence for a while, but moisture may continue damaging materials behind the finished surface.

Do Not Rule Out Plumbing or Condensation

Not every recurring wet spot comes from outside.

A slow plumbing leak can drip behind a wall or travel along a pipe before collecting in one place. Check whether there is a bathroom, kitchen, laundry area, outdoor faucet, water heater, or supply line near the affected section.

Condensation can also create dampness around cold-water pipes, air-conditioning equipment, ductwork, or cool foundation walls. This is especially common when warm, humid air enters a cooler basement.

Timing is one of the best clues. Water that appears only after rainfall is more likely connected to exterior drainage or groundwater. Moisture that develops when an appliance runs or during humid weather may have a different source.

Keep a Record of What Happens

A recurring leak is easier to understand when you document it.

Take photographs before cleaning the area. Write down when the water appeared, how heavily it had been raining, whether the sump pump was running, and how long the basement took to dry.

You can also use a small piece of painter’s tape to mark the edge of a stain or damp area. During the next storm, check whether the moisture spreads beyond that point.

This simple record may reveal patterns that are difficult to remember when weeks pass between storms. It can also give a waterproofing professional useful information if the basement is dry on the day of the inspection.

Use caution when inspecting or cleaning standing water near electrical outlets, appliances, extension cords, or other electrical equipment.

Cleanup Is Not the Same as a Repair

Drying the floor, running fans, and using a dehumidifier are all reasonable cleanup steps. They can reduce lingering moisture and help protect nearby belongings.

However, cleaning up the water does not prevent it from returning.

The correct repair depends on the source. It may involve extending a downspout, improving the grading, clearing a window well drain, repairing a foundation crack, servicing a sump pump, correcting a plumbing leak, or installing a drainage system.

Use the Location as a Clue

Seeing water return to the same area is frustrating, but the pattern can make the problem easier to investigate.

Start outside and look at how water moves around that section of the house. Check the gutters, downspouts, grading, windows, visible cracks, plumbing, and nearby basement materials. Pay attention to whether the moisture appears immediately during rain or develops several hours later.

Most importantly, do not assume that repainting the wall or drying the floor has corrected the underlying issue. Identifying why the water keeps following the same path is the first step toward keeping it from returning.
